Listen to pronunciation Share definition A work week ending on a Thursday due to a holiday or similar circumstance that turns Friday into a day off from work. Manager: "Due to the inclement weather expected tomorrow, Friday will be a snow day." Worker: "Woo-hoo! Thursday-Friday!" by principalstress February 14, 2009 Flag mugGet the Thursday-Friday mug.
